Nolan Wells Death: See United Cajun Navy's Investigative Report
Key Points:
- The United Cajun Navy's investigative report into Nolan Wells' death includes a new photo showing three boats anchored off Mississippi's Horn Island on July 4, including the Triton, which left the island without Nolan after taking on water.
- Nolan's friend Warren Hudson stated that he and others urged Nolan to board their boat around 4:30 PM, but Nolan refused; the Triton reportedly left the island at 4:31 PM.
- A woman named Katelynn Brochard took a photo of the anchored boats around 7:30 PM and noted Nolan was not visible when her group left the island.
- The last independently confirmed sighting of Nolan was between 3:23 PM and 4:27 PM, with significant questions remaining about his whereabouts after that time.
- Nolan was found dead on July 6 near where he was last seen alive; an independent autopsy listed the cause and manner of death as "undetermined," while the official Mississippi autopsy results have not yet been released.
